When working with air-sensitive samples in a research or laboratory setting, maintaining the integrity of the sample is crucial for accurate results. Traditional microscopy techniques can be challenging to use with these samples due to their sensitivity to air exposure. However, a glovebox-assisted magnetic force microscope offers a solution to this problem.

A glovebox provides a controlled environment with low levels of oxygen and moisture, allowing researchers to handle air-sensitive samples without the risk of contamination. By integrating a magnetic force microscope into the glovebox setup, researchers can easily image and analyze these samples without compromising their quality.

Benefits of Glovebox-assisted Magnetic Force Microscope:

  • Protection: The glovebox environment protects air-sensitive samples from exposure to oxygen and moisture, preserving their properties.
  • Precision: The magnetic force microscope offers high-resolution imaging capabilities, allowing researchers to study samples in detail.
  • Convenience: By combining the glovebox with the microscope, researchers can perform imaging and analysis in a single controlled environment.

Overall, the glovebox-assisted magnetic force microscope provides a convenient and effective solution for researchers working with air-sensitive samples. By maintaining a controlled environment and utilizing advanced imaging techniques, researchers can obtain accurate and reliable results without the risk of sample degradation.
